Transaction ccde735e2663cbfb78f3ebc622593fec003513a29da70fd913563d383ac9e79a
1 Input
1 Output
-
ccde735e2663cbfb78f3ebc622593fec003513a29da70fd913563d383ac9e79a:0
- value
- 19598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a98ff770b898fcc54292fa430684cc39333781d6 OP_EQUAL
- address
- 3H9aawCdHs2itcqaiNbYn3Va3JftThGGZK